> I'm looking into purchasing some new editing software because I'm
> quite fed up with windows movie maker, does anyone know of any really
> good editing programs that export in the quicktime format and cost
> less than $100? Thanks.
>

Ulead VideoStudio 9 is less than $99 AND outputs to .mov format (as well as tons of other formats) you can try it for free for 30 days at www.ulead.com
 
If you need help with downloading the program file then use this great free software called "Star Downloader" at web with same name.
 
Avid/Pinnacle Studio 9 does not output to mov format, but a small chance the new version 10 might since Avid bought and repackaged $99 Pinnacle Studio. It also has limited free trial at www.pinnaclesys.com 
 
Always try before you buy. All three $99 sotware are much better than Windows Movie Maker: Ulead, Pinnacle, and Adobe Elements.
 
If you hate Windows Movie Maker you will hate even more the Avid Free DV--very very limiting on outputs and creative options. It is very good at talking over newbies heads though :-)
